In January of 2012, I will be embarking on an epic fundraising challenge to climb Mount Kilimanjaro, which is the highest mountain in Africa and the tallest free-standing mountain in the world at 19340feet.

I will be doing this on behalf of Scope, the charity for people with cerebral palsy. Cerebral palsy is the most commonly diagnosed physical condition in the UK, and occurs around the time of birth when part of the brain fails to develop properly. It can happen to any child.

The money raised from my Kilimanjaro trip will allow Scope to continue running their vital services which are designed to support disabled people in every aspect of their lives from birth through to adulthood.
